What is the percentage increase/decrease from 283 to 5572?

Answer: The percentage change is 1868.9%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 283 to 5572?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 283\)
• \(Y = 5572\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({5572-283 \over 283}\) = \({5289 \over 283}\) = \(18.689045936396\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(18.689\) = \(1868.9 \over 100 \) = \(1868.9\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 1868.9%.
